The Age of Crocodilians and Their Kin: Anatomy, Physiology, and Evolution

Speakers: Drs. Casey Holliday and Emma Schachner

Casey Holliday is an Associate Professor in Integrative Anatomy in the Department of Pathology and Anatomical Sciences at the University of Missouri School of Medicine. Emma R. Schachner is an Associate Professor in the Department of Cell Biology and Anatomy at Louisiana State University Health Sciences Center. Drs. Holliday and Schachner are co-Guest Editors of an upcoming volume of The Anatomical Record on crocodyliform evolution, functional morphology, and paleobiology. The presentation will focus on recent advances in the biology and paleontology of this fascinating lineage of vertebrates. The presenters will discuss how researchers bring crocodylians and their extinct ancestors to life using a variety of approaches including fieldwork, imaging, 3D modeling, developmental biology, physiological monitoring, dissection, and a host of other comparative methods.
